Conventional Lathe Operator Course

What will I learn?

Learn how to use a lathe properly with our Conventional Lathe Operator Training. This training is for welders and turning professionals who want to improve their skills. You'll learn important things like how to stay safe, what personal protective equipment (PPE) to use, and how to handle metal. We'll also cover the basics of metallurgy, including different types of metal, their properties, and how to choose the right one. You'll become skilled in quality control, choosing the right materials, and using machining techniques. Learn how to set up a lathe accurately, calibrate it, and adjust the spindle speed to get the correct sizes and finishes. Improve your job prospects with this practical, high-quality training.
